>> AGE RELAXATION :

  • Upper age limit is relaxable by 5 years for SC/ST and by 3 years for OBC candidates.
  • Upper age limit is relaxable for departmental candidates’ upto 40 years in accordance with the instructions or orders issued by the Central Government from time to time.
  • The age limit is relaxable up to age of 35 years for general candidates and up to 40 years for SC/ST in case of widows, divorced women and women judicially separated from their husbands and not remarried.
  • The age limit is relaxable for ex-servicemen as well as for candidates who were domiciled in J&K from Jan 01, 1980 to Dec 31, 1989 as well as the children and dependents of victims of communal riots of 2002 in Gujarat as per the Government instructions in this regard issued by the Central Government from time to time.

>> SELECTION PROCESS OF CANDIDATES :

  • The candidate has to appear in the written examination (Paper-I and Paper-II) at one of the test centres mentioned above. Paper-II of only those candidates will be evaluated who come up to a certain standard in Paper-I. On the basis of their combined performance in Paper-I and Paper-II, the candidates would be shortlisted for the trade test, the date, place and time of which would be intimated to the candidates at their email ID provided at the time of online registration. The candidates would also have an option to download their admit cards if they do not receive it by email. Based on the performance of the candidates in the written test (objective and descriptive) and trade test, they will be selected subject to successful completion of their Character and Antecedent verification followed by medical examination.
  • The trade test need not necessarily be conducted at the centre opted and may be conducted at a centre by clubbing candidates of nearby centres.
